Marijuana Prevention Initiative (MPI): The San Diego County MPI works to reduce youth access to marijuana by increasing public awareness regarding the adverse effects resulting from youth marijuana use. They aim to decrease community acceptance and tolerance of marijuana use and access among youth living in San Diego between the ages of 12-25.
